Editor IDE
Et letvægtig editor IDE i browseren til udviklere og forfattere, der kan skrive, redigere, lint, forhåndsvise og eksportere kode og Markdown med minimalt setup.

Tjek det selv
Om dette værktøj
Editor IDE- værktøjet tilbyder et browserbaseret redigeringsmiljø til udviklere og forfattere, der ikke har brug for lokal installation, til at skrive kode og Markdown, anvende let linting, forhåndsvise indhold og eksportere artefakter. Primære brugere er solo-udviklere, tekniske forfattere og små teams der prototyper dokumentation eller vejledninger. Brug sker ved projektstart, under dokumentations-sprint eller når kørbare snippets deles uden en desktop-IDE.
Kernelogik & Funktioner: Domænekapaciteter inkluderer et multi-filers browser-nativt workspace, sprogbevidst syntaksfremhævning og realtidslinting. Nødvendige funktioner: in-browser editorpaneler, per-fil sprog, lokal persistens og deterministiske exports. Valgfrie funktioner: versionerede snippets, projektskabeloner, offline-tilstand og udvidelsesbare extensions. Værktøjet håndterer en lokal datalagring, anvender sproggrammer og dirigerer indhold til en bærbar eksport-pipeline, der bevarer struktur og metadata.
Ind- og udgange: Inddata består af filer (array af {name, language, content}), redigeringsmode (Code eller Markdown), valgfri autosave, export_format og locale. Eksempel: files=[{name:'main.js',language:'javascript',content:'console.log(\\"hi\\");'}], mode:'code', export_format:'zip'. Uddata omfatter status, exported_files (array med name, URL, size, format), previews og diagnostiske meddelelser. Validering: ikke-tomme navne, understøttede sprog og UTF-8-indhold; valgte inputs standardiseres til browserlagring og standard eksportmuligheder.
Algoritmer & Udregninger: Værktøjet bruger sprog-specifikke parsere til syntaksfremhævning, en Markdown-render til forudvisninger og en pakke-rutine til eksport. Lint-regler er letvægt og sprogafhængige; forudvisninger beregnes klient-side fra det aktuelle indhold uden at ændre semantik. Versionering bruger tidsstempelbaserede identifikatorer.
Fejl & Kanttilfælde: Ugyldige eller manglende inputs udløser valideringsfejl uden UI-interaktion. Store filer uden for en konfigureret grænse afvises; ikke-gemt ændringer spores; offline-drift begrænses til lokal lagring. Ikke-understøttede sprog falder tilbage til ren tekst med metadata. Eksport-fejl returnerer strukturerede fejlkoder i stedet for stack traces.
Industri/Region & Lokalisation: UTF-8-kodning; lokalt tilpassede meddelelser hvor tilgængelige; linjeskift tilpasses LF eller CRLF; ingen valuta- eller regionale formater, medmindre brugeren angiver dem. Data forbliver lokale, medmindre eksplicit synkronisering anvendes. Antagelser & Udelukkelser: Ikke en fuldkomponent compiler eller server-IDE; netværksfunktioner, realtidssamarbejde og pakkehåndtering ligger uden for omfanget. Udformet til offline-venlighed og ikke ekstern build uden brugerens konfiguration.
Sådan bruges
1. Initialiser arbejdsområde, tilføj filer og vælg sprog for kode eller Markdown.
2. Rediger indhold med syntaksfremhævning og live linting.
3. Forhåndsvis Markdown- eller kode-rendering i det indbyggede panel.
4. Eksporter projektet eller enkelte filer til formater som TXT, Markdown, HTML eller ZIP.
5. Gem lokalt eller aktiver synkronisering for at bevare arbejde over sessioner.

Ofte stillede spørgsmål / yderligere ressourcer
Find hurtige svar
Er dette værktøj en erstatning for en fuld IDE?
Kan jeg arbejde offline?
Hvilke formater kan jeg eksportere?
Brugeranmeldelser
Se hvad andre siger
Udforsk relaterede værktøjer
Flere løsninger til dine behov
iPhone Editor
Et mobilredigeringsværktøj til iPhone, der lader forfattere og udviklere udforme, redigere og organisere tekst eller kode offline.
Billedredigerer til iPhone-fotos
En præcis billedredigerer til iPhone-fotos, der muliggør hurtige, ikke-destruktive justeringer og eksport i typiske formater.
Din feedback betyder noget
Hjælp os med at forbedre